What they do

An Automotive Service Technician or Mechanic repairs and performs maintenance on cars and smaller trucks; may conduct auto inspections.

$48,180 / year median in North Carolina

+10% projected growth

Job Description

Job Overview Join our team as an Automotive Mechanic, where your expertise will drive vehicle performance and customer satisfaction. In this role, you will diagnose, repair, and maintain a wide range of vehicles, ensuring they operate safely and efficiently. Your mechanical knowledge and hands-on skills will be vital in delivering top-tier automotive service. We value proactive problem-solving and a passion for automotive excellence to keep our clients moving confidently on the road. Responsibilities Perform comprehensive diagnostics using automotive electrical systems, schematics, and advanced diagnostic tools to identify issues accurately. Conduct repairs on mechanical systems including engines, transmissions, suspensions, brakes, shocks & struts, and powertrain components. Execute routine maintenance. Utilize hand tools, power tools, welding equipment, and other mechanical tools to complete repairs efficiently. Interpret technical manuals and schematics to troubleshoot complex automotive electrical systems. Qualifications Proven experience working in the automotive repair industry with a strong background in dealership or independent shop environments. Extensive knowledge of automotive mechanical systems including transmissions, powertrains, suspension systems, brakes, and electrical components. Hands-on experience with diesel engine repair is highly desirable. Familiarity with automotive diagnostics software and schematics for accurate troubleshooting. Ability to operate hand tools, power tools, welding equipment, and other mechanical repair tools safely and effectively. Strong mechanical knowledge complemented by exc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ail. Join us to be part of a passionate team dedicated to automotive excellence!
